IMDbPY is a Python package useful to retrieve and manage the data of the IMDb movie database about movies, people, characters and companies. Platform-independent, it can retrieve data from both the IMDb's web server and a local copy of the whole db.

ToonLoop is a live stop motion animation performance tool. The idea is to spread its use for teaching new medias to children and to give a professional tool for movie creators. ToonLoop is a free software art project. An original idea by Alexandre Quessy. See http://alexandre.quessy.net/?q=too

This class was part of a bigger project to provide DPX native support to a MacOS X application. The original project was defeated and now it has been partially released as different classes to do many things in a simple way. This class is written in standard C++ in order to provide an easy way to ... [More] access DPX files (metadata and images). Could be used to provide basic support to other complex classes or programs. As this class was originally designed for loading and making simple modifications on existing files there are many things to add: Cineon support (quite easy); DPX creation from the scratch (easy); interface methods to other classes such as CIImage (Mac OS X Core Image)... and whatever you want to contribute.
